How AI Agents Are Transforming Enterprise Software and Business Automation

Artificial Intelligence has evolved far beyond answering questions or generating content.

Today, AI can schedule meetings, analyze business reports, respond to customers, update CRM records, generate code, and even coordinate multiple software systems with minimal human involvement.

These intelligent systems are known as AI agents.

Unlike traditional chatbots that wait for user instructions, AI agents can understand goals, make decisions, use external tools, and complete tasks from start to finish.

For businesses, this represents a major shift in how work gets done.

Instead of automating a single repetitive task, organizations can now automate entire business processes.

Why Businesses Are Investing in AI Agents

Most automation platforms follow predefined rules.

If a process changes unexpectedly, traditional automation usually stops working until someone updates the workflow.

AI agents work differently.

They can interpret new information, adjust their approach, and choose the most appropriate action based on changing situations.

This flexibility makes them valuable across industries where business operations are constantly evolving.

From Simple Automation to Intelligent Decision-Making

Traditional automation answers one question:

"If this happens, then do that."

AI agents answer a much more advanced question:

"What is the best action based on everything happening right now?"

This ability allows agents to:

  • Analyze incoming data
  • Access business systems
  • Use APIs
  • Search internal knowledge bases
  • Generate recommendations
  • Complete multi-step workflows
  • Learn from previous interactions

Rather than following rigid instructions, AI agents adapt their behavior to achieve business objectives more effectively.

Why Governance Matters in AI Agent Development

Greater autonomy also introduces greater responsibility.

An AI agent with access to company systems can perform useful actions—but without proper controls, it may also make costly mistakes.

Imagine an AI agent accidentally deleting customer records, sending incorrect emails, or triggering unnecessary workflows.

These risks highlight the importance of responsible implementation.

Modern enterprise AI solutions often include:

  • Approval workflows
  • Human review for sensitive actions
  • Permission-based access controls
  • Continuous monitoring
  • Activity logging
  • Risk detection
  • Rollback mechanisms

These safeguards allow businesses to benefit from AI automation while maintaining operational control.

Solving Complex Problems with Multi-Agent Collaboration

One AI agent doesn't need to perform every task.

In fact, dividing responsibilities often produces better results.

This concept is known as Multi-Agent Orchestration.

Rather than relying on one large AI model, businesses deploy multiple specialized agents that work together.

For example:

  • A planning agent defines the overall strategy.
  • A research agent gathers relevant information.
  • An execution agent completes the required tasks.
  • A validation agent reviews the final output before delivery.

Each agent focuses on a specific responsibility, improving accuracy while reducing unnecessary complexity.

This modular approach also makes enterprise AI systems easier to monitor, maintain, and scale.

Industries Already Using AI Agents

AI agents are rapidly transforming operations across multiple sectors.

Healthcare

Assist with patient scheduling, documentation, and administrative workflows.

Financial Services

Support fraud detection, compliance checks, and financial reporting.

Manufacturing

Monitor production systems and optimize maintenance schedules.

Retail

Improve inventory planning, customer engagement, and personalized shopping experiences.

Logistics

Coordinate shipments, optimize delivery routes, and monitor supply chain operations in real time.

As AI technology continues to mature, these use cases will only expand.
